跳到主要内容

如何查看与分析查看Tomcat日志 ?

参考答案:

查看和分析Tomcat日志是维护和管理Tomcat服务器的重要任务之一。下面是一些步骤和提示,帮助你有效地查看和分析Tomcat日志:

一、查看Tomcat日志

  1. 找到Tomcat的日志文件夹
  • 在Windows下,Tomcat的默认日志路径通常在C:\Tomcat\logs目录下。
  • 在Linux系统中,默认的Tomcat日志路径是/var/log/tomcat/logs
  • Tomcat的日志通常位于其安装目录下的logs文件夹中。
  1. 使用文本编辑器查看日志
  • 你可以使用任何文本编辑器(如vi、nano、gedit、notepad++等)打开这些日志文件。
  1. 命令行查看日志(针对Unix/Linux系统)
  • 使用tail命令可以查看最新的日志信息。例如,tail -f logs/catalina.out会实时显示catalina.out文件的末尾内容,方便你查看最新的Tomcat日志。

二、分析Tomcat日志

  1. 了解常见的日志文件
  • catalina.out:这是最主要的日志文件,记录了Tomcat服务器的启动、运行和关闭等重要事件。如果你在启动或运行过程中遇到问题,这个文件将是你的首要检查点。
  • localhost.log:这个文件记录了与localhost关联的web应用的日志信息。如果这些应用出现问题,你可以在这个文件中找到相关信息。
  • manager.log:Tomcat下默认manager应用日志,记录了管理操作的相关信息。
  • 其他日志文件:如host-manager.log等,也提供了关于Tomcat运行的不同方面的信息。
  1. 分析日志内容
  • 仔细查看日志文件中的错误和异常信息。这些通常会以“ERROR”或“EXCEPTION”等关键词标识。
  • 注意查看与你的应用程序或特定操作相关的日志条目,这有助于你定位问题。
  1. 配置和自定义日志
  • 你可以通过编辑conf/logging.properties文件来配置Tomcat的日志级别、输出格式和位置等。
  • 通过配置conf/server.xml文件中的<Valve>标签,你可以自定义日志的输出路径。
  1. 使用日志分析工具
  • 对于大量的日志数据,你可以考虑使用专门的日志分析工具或软件,如ELK Stack(Elasticsearch、Logstash和Kibana)等,来帮助你更有效地分析和处理日志数据。

通过以上步骤,你应该能够查看和分析Tomcat的日志,并据此诊断和解决Tomcat服务器或应用程序中的问题。记得定期查看和分析日志,以便及时发现和解决潜在的问题。